Al Khaleej preview

Al Khaleej comes into the match having played 16 games in the Saudi Pro League so far. They have recorded 7 wins, 3 draws, and 6 losses, with an average of 1.5 points per game in the tournament.

In the 2025/26 season across all competitions, the team has achieved 11 wins, 7 draws, and 14 losses.

Al Khaleej's attack has scored 62 goals during this period. Out of this total, 37 goals were scored in the Saudi Pro League, averaging 2.31 goals per match. The season's average stands at 1.94.

The offense system of Al Khaleej is led by Joshua King as the top scorer of the season. The norwegian forward has scored 13 goals. He is supported by the season's best assistant, Konstantinos Fortounis, who has contributed with 10 assists.

On the defensive side, the team has conceded 27 goals with an average of 1.69 in the league. In all competitions, the current numbers are 53 goals conceded in 32 matches, resulting in an average of 1.66.

Al Shabab preview

On the other hand, Al Shabab comes into the match having played 16 games in the Saudi Pro League so far. They have recorded 2 wins, 6 draws, and 8 losses, with an average of 0.75 points per game in the tournament.

In the 2025/26 season across all competitions, the team has achieved 3 wins, 7 draws, and 9 losses.

Al Shabab's attack has scored 18 goals during this period. Out of this total, 14 goals were scored in the Saudi Pro League, averaging 0.88 goals per match. The season's average stands at 0.95.

The offense system of Al Shabab is led by Yannick Carrasco as the top scorer of the season. The belgian forward has scored 7 goals. He is supported by the season's best assistant, Yannick Carrasco, who has contributed with 3 assists.

On the defensive side, the team has conceded 25 goals with an average of 1.56 in the league. In all competitions, the current numbers are 31 goals conceded in 19 matches, resulting in an average of 1.63.
